## Tuning

The Ashfield tax-rate lookup cache holds jurisdiction rates in memory with a signed snapshot fallback. Entries are validated against the upstream rate service before reuse, and stale entries are never served past the hard TTL. All cache behavior is controlled by the constants below.

tuning constants:
QUOTAS = {
    "druwyn": 5,
    "holix": 5,
    "zorath": 5,
    "holwyn": 10,
}

Subject: GC pauses in Pairwell matcher — release 4.12

Team,

During soak testing of the Pairwell matching service we observed garbage-collection pauses up to 900ms under peak candidate load. We switched to the generational collector and capped heap at 6GB, which brought pauses under 120ms. No data handling paths changed; the allocator tuning is config-only, so the prior security review remains valid. Rollout proceeds tonight behind the usual canary gate. The exact build under review is identified by the token below.

pipeline stamp: htk9_ce63042d9

Subject: Key rotation for Farethorn rules engine

Hi all — as part of quarterly hygiene, we rotated the credentials for Farethorn, our shipping-fee rules engine. The old key stops working Friday at noon. Update your local env files and any personal test scripts before then; CI has already been updated. The new staging key for Farethorn is included below.

gateway credential: vxb4-QTMv

## Configuration — Spoolio

Spoolio is our little printer-spooler microservice, and it's fussy about its env file. Copy `example.env` to `.env` before doing anything else. `SPOOLIO_PORT` defaults to 7170; `MAX_JOB_BYTES` caps oversized print jobs so the Drexhall office plotter doesn't choke. Queue state lives in the Inkwell broker, so point `INKWELL_HOST` at staging unless you enjoy surprises. One last thing: the broker credential goes on the line right after this sentence.

sealed setting: VAULT_KEY5=54f99